Figure 5

Predominant increase in the number of mt-nucleoids was observed during the S phase. (a) The number of mt-nucleoids per cell in each cell cycle phase. SYBR Green I-stained mt-nucleoids were counted in Fucci2 cells in each phase. Error bars indicate standard deviation (Early G1 ncells = 19, G1 ncells = 22, Early-middle S ncells = 78, Late S-G2 ncells = 42). (b) The period of time-lapse imaging for the experiment in Fig. 5c. Fucci2 cells were classified into five phases depending on the change in color of their nucleus. (c) Increase in the number of mt-nucleoids within 4 h during the cell cycle. We stained Fucci2 cells with 1:300,000 SYBR Green I, and performed time-lapse imaging at 4-h intervals in each cell cycle phase presented in Fig. 5b, after which we counted the mt-nucleoid number at 0 and 4 h. Error bars indicate standard deviation (ncells = 10 for each phase).
